Price Analysis of Modified Epoxy Resin Adhesives
In modern industrial production, adhesives serve as a critical bonding material with extensive applications across industries such as construction, automotive manufacturing, and aerospace. Among these, modified epoxy resin adhesives have gained significant attention due to their superior bonding properties and broad application prospects. This article explores the factors influencing the pricing of modified epoxy resin adhesives and their impact on the market.
1. Composition and Classification of Modified Epoxy Resin Adhesives
Modified epoxy resin adhesives primarily consist of a resin matrix, curing agents, thinners, fillers, and other components. Based on specific application scenarios and performance requirements, they are classified into various types, including epoxy-based, polyurethane-based, and acrylate-based adhesives. Differences in composition and performance among these types directly influence their pricing.
2. Cost Factors Affecting Pricing
a. Raw Material Costs: The resin matrix, a core component of adhesives, significantly impacts overall costs. Prices vary widely between standard and specialized resins. Additionally, procurement channels and supplier negotiations affect raw material expenses.
b. Formulation Costs: Adjustments to formulations—such as adding curing agents, thinners, or fillers, or altering their ratios—may enhance performance but also increase costs, subsequently raising the product’s price.
c. Production Processes: Energy consumption, equipment investment, and labor costs during manufacturing influence pricing. Advanced production techniques can improve efficiency, reduce energy use, and lower costs.
3. Market Demand and Price Fluctuations
a. Market Demand: Accelerated industrialization has driven rising demand for adhesives, particularly in construction and automotive sectors. This surge has propelled price increases for modified epoxy resin adhesives.
b. Price Competition: In a market-driven economy, price competition is key to securing market share. Some enterprises reduce costs by lowering raw material prices or improving efficiency, thereby impacting industry-wide pricing.
4. Policy and Environmental Regulations
a. Government Policies: Regulatory and taxation policies affect pricing. For instance, stricter environmental standards may raise raw material costs, which are subsequently passed onto consumers.
b. Environmental Requirements: Growing environmental awareness has prompted enterprises to invest in eco-friendly formulations. Research and development (R&D) and process upgrades to meet sustainability goals often increase production costs, influencing final prices.
5. Market Competition and Corporate Strategies
a. Market Competition: Intense competition may lead enterprises to lower prices to capture market share, shaping industry pricing trends.
b. Corporate Strategies: Business decisions such as scaling production, optimizing supply chains, or enhancing product quality strengthen competitiveness and influence pricing dynamics.
the pricing of modified epoxy resin adhesives is determined by multiple factors, including raw material costs, formulation complexity, production processes, market demand, policy regulations, and competition. Understanding these factors helps consumers make informed purchasing decisions. Meanwhile, enterprises must stay attuned to market trends and adopt strategic pricing to ensure sustainable growth.
